Description and Introduction

Low-Noise Precision Operaional Amplifiers The **OP27FZ** is a high-precision operational amplifier (op-amp) designed for applications requiring low noise, high accuracy, and excellent DC performance. This component is widely used in instrumentation, medical equipment, and audio systems where signal integrity is critical.  

Featuring low input offset voltage and minimal drift over temperature, the OP27FZ ensures reliable amplification in sensitive circuits. Its low noise characteristics make it particularly suitable for amplifying weak signals without introducing significant distortion. Additionally, the device offers a high open-loop gain and a wide bandwidth, enabling stable operation across various frequency ranges.  

The OP27FZ is housed in an 8-pin DIP package, providing ease of integration into both prototyping and production environments. Its robust design includes built-in protection against overvoltage and short-circuit conditions, enhancing long-term reliability.  

Engineers often select the OP27FZ for precision analog circuits, including data acquisition systems, strain gauge amplifiers, and high-fidelity audio processing. Its combination of performance and durability makes it a preferred choice in demanding applications where accuracy and stability are paramount.  

For optimal results, proper PCB layout and decoupling techniques should be employed to minimize noise and ensure consistent operation.
